Client Assistance
Application process
 

An EMI team creates documentation for earth quake resistant housing in North India.

1) The first step in the application process is to fill in a preliminary application. Click here to download the application. EMI UK will review the preliminary application and, depending on the nature and scope of the proposed project, may request additional information. Send an email or call us if you have questions.

2) After project approval, EMI UK will mobilize a team of design professionals consisting of Architects, Engineers, Planners and/or Surveyors, as appropriate. The team typically spends one week with your organization, working closely with you to turn your vision into a design on paper.

3) Following our time with you, the team will spend time at home putting together the design plans. These plans can start with coloured renderings to be used to assist you in raising the money needed for construction, to communicate your vision and work with local officials, or in your planning. As well, they can become construction documents from which the buildings can be constructed. EMI UK is able to work with you to determine your needs and then to develop the drawings as required.

4) On occasion, we can also mobilize construction managers to assist you during construction. Contact us at enquiries@emiuk.org for information regarding construction management services.
